Source: KPAX SEELEY LAKE – Lolo National Forest managers are beginning to take comment on plans to salvage several thousand acres of timber from last summer’s massive Rice Ridge Fire. The lightning-caused fire scorched over 160,000 acres and was the largest fire in Western Montana last summer. While much of the area is too steep […]
